Understand nameservers
Nameservers are part of a domain’s DNS settings. By updating nameservers to those specified by Kajabi, you delegate DNS management for your domain to Kajabi’s Cloudflare integration. It’s important to use only the nameservers provided in your Kajabi account during setup as these are specific to your domain.Update nameservers
Follow these steps to update your Nameservers:- Log in to your domain registrar: Access the account where you manage your domain’s DNS settings, such as GoDaddy, Namecheap, or InMotion Hosting.
- Locate nameserver settings: Find the section where your domain’s nameservers are configured. This is usually under DNS management or domain settings.
- Replace existing nameservers: Use the nameservers provided by Kajabi. These may include pairs like
jermaine.ns.cloudflare.comandjoyce.ns.cloudflare.comImportant: Always refer to the Kajabi-provided nameservers displayed in your Domain settings or setup instructions for accuracy. - Save changes: Confirm the update and save your settings.
- Wait for DNS propagation: Allow up to 24 hours for the changes to propagate globally. During this time, your domain may not resolve to Kajabi immediately.
Registrar-specific instructions
Some registrars may have unique processes for updating nameservers:- InMotion Hosting: Log in to your account, navigate to DNS settings, and replace your current nameservers (e.g.,
ns.inmotionhosting.com) with the Kajabi-provided nameservers. Save changes, and allow propagation time. - Namecheap: Enter the Kajabi-provided nameservers directly into the “Custom DNS” field and save your settings.
Troubleshooting
- Troubleshooting downtime: If your Kajabi site is inaccessible after updating nameservers, confirm that only the specified nameservers are in use and no others are configured. Ensure you are using the exact pair provided in your Kajabi account.
- Custom nameservers: Avoid using general Cloudflare nameservers (e.g., alexis.ns.cloudflare.com) that are not specifically provided by Kajabi.
- Propagation time: Allow 24-48 hours for DNS propagation. Kajabi will notify you when your domain successfully connects.
After your nameservers are set, avoid these actions that can reset them:
- GoDaddy forwarding rules: Adding or editing a forwarding rule in GoDaddy resets your domain’s nameservers back to GoDaddy’s servers. If you need HTTP → HTTPS redirection, do not set this up in GoDaddy — the redirect is handled automatically once the domain is connected to Kajabi.
- Domain renewals: Some registrars restore default nameservers during a domain renewal. After renewing, verify your Kajabi nameservers are still in place.
- Domain transfers: Transferring a domain to a new registrar will reset nameservers. After any transfer, re-apply Kajabi’s nameservers.
